Cervical Radiculopathy Caused by a Vertebral Artery Loop: Is a Focused Fluoroscopic‐Guided Cervical Epidural Steroid Injection a Possible Treatment Modality?

Abstract: We describe a case of a patient suffering with cervical radiculopathy due to vertebral artery loop with nerve root compression, treated with an epidural steroid injection. A 37‐year‐old man presented with a 2‐year history of right‐sided radicular pain along the C7 dermatome. Imaging showed a right‐sided loop of the vertebral artery at the V1–V2 transition with contact on the C7 nerve root.
